Mr. Thomas Ernest King, age 92, of Unionville, TN, died Saturday, December 2, 2017, at Harton Regional Medical Center, Tullahoma. Mr. King was born in the Longview Community on September 9, 1925, to F Z King and Clatie E. Neal King. He attended Coopertown School. Over the years, Mr. King worked at Empire Pencil Company, Shelbyville Pure Milk Company, and owned and operated King Egg Company which delivered eggs all over Middle Tennessee. He was a Rural Mail Carrier for many years before he retired. Mr. King attended Enon Primitive Baptist Church.
In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his wife of 61 years, Ruth Stephens King; brother, Garland King; and sisters, Nancy King Smotherman, Jean King Sudberry, and baby sister, Clatie Elizabeth King.
